A The Picture Control Grid
To display a grid showing saturation (non-monochrome controls
only) and contrast for the Picture Control selected in Step 2, press and
hold the X button.
The icons for Picture Controls that use auto contrast and saturation
are displayed in green in the Picture Control grid, and lines appear
parallel to the axes of the grid.

A Filter Effects (Monochrome Only)
The options in this menu simulate the effect of color filters on monochrome photographs.
The following filter effects are available:
Option Description
Y Yellow
Enhances contrast.
Can be used to tone down the brightness of the sky in
landscape photographs.
Orange produces more contrast than yellow, red
more contrast than orange.
O Orange
R Red
G Green Softens skin tones.
Can be used for portraits.
Note that the effects achieved with Filter effects are more pronounced than those
produced by physical glass filters.
A Toning (Monochrome Only)
Choose from B&W (black-and-white), Sepia, Cyanotype (blue-tinted
monochrome), Red, Ye l lo w , Green, Blue Green, Blue, Purple Blue,
Red Purple.
Pressing 3 when Toning is selected displays saturation
options.
Press 4 or 2 to adjust saturation.
Saturation control is not
available when B&W (black-and-white) is selected.
